Choosing the Right Plants for Vertical Gardens

Vertical gardens are a fantastic way to bring greenery into your living space, whether you have a small apartment balcony or a large outdoor area. When it comes to selecting plants for your vertical garden, there are several factors to consider, such as light conditions, maintenance requirements, and visual appeal. Here are some tips to help you choose the right plants for your vertical garden:

Light Conditions

Before selecting plants for your vertical garden, assess the light conditions in the area where you plan to install it. Some plants thrive in full sun, while others prefer shade. Choose plants that are suited to the amount of light available to ensure they thrive.

Low-Maintenance Options

If you're looking for low-maintenance plants for your vertical garden, consider the following options:

  • Succulents

    Succulents are excellent choices for vertical gardens as they require minimal watering and care. They come in a variety of shapes, sizes, and colors, making them versatile and visually appealing.

  • Air Plants

    Air plants are unique in that they don't need soil to grow. They absorb nutrients and moisture from the air, making them incredibly low-maintenance and perfect for vertical gardens.

  • Spider Plants

    Spider plants are known for their air-purifying properties and are easy to care for. They can thrive in a variety of light conditions, making them a versatile choice for vertical gardens.

By selecting the right plants for your vertical garden, you can create a beautiful and thriving green space with minimal effort. Consider the light conditions and maintenance requirements of the plants to ensure they flourish in their vertical environment.

Remember to regularly check on your plants, water them as needed, and provide any necessary care to keep your vertical garden looking its best.
